Resilient Connectivity of IoT Using Aerial Networks

2021 
Enabling the Internet of things in remote environments without traditional communication infrastructure requires a multi‐layer network architecture. Devices in the overlay network such as un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s) are required to provide coverage to underlay devices as well as remain connected to other overlay devices to exploit device‐to‐device (D2D) communication. This chapter provides a mechanism for aerial base stations to create a formation over ground users for providing maximum coverage as well as connectivity.
